Primary pericardial mesothelioma.

Cristina Santos1, Jesus Montesinos, Eva Castañer

  • 1Hospital de Sabadell, Corporació Parc Taulí, Institut Universitari, Sabadell-Barcelona, Spain.

Lung Cancer (Amsterdam, Netherlands)
|October 16, 2007
PubMed
Summary

Primary pericardial mesothelioma is a rare and aggressive cancer. Chemotherapy and radiotherapy showed initial response but limited survival, highlighting the need for novel treatments.

Area of Science:

  • Oncology
  • Thoracic Surgery

Background:

  • Primary pericardial mesothelioma is an exceptionally rare and aggressive malignancy.
  • Characterized by a poor prognosis, with survival typically less than six months.

Observation:

  • A case report of a 44-year-old male diagnosed with primary pericardial mesothelioma.
  • Initial treatment involved a clinical trial with carboplatin and pemetrexed, achieving a tumor response.
  • Consolidation radiotherapy was administered following chemotherapy.

Findings:

  • Tumor progression was observed ten months post-radiotherapy.
  • Second-line chemotherapy was initiated for progressive disease.
  • The patient's overall survival was 16 months from diagnosis.

Implications:

  • This case underscores the aggressive nature of primary pericardial mesothelioma.
  • The limited efficacy of current treatment regimens suggests a need for more effective therapeutic strategies.
  • Advancements in cytotoxic drugs may offer improved survival outcomes for this rare cancer.
